Frequently asked questions about weather in Long Beach
How warm does it get in Long Beach?
The warmest month in Long Beach is August, with average high temperatures of 19°C. The average temperature during this period is around 16°C.
How cold does it get in Long Beach?
The coldest month in Long Beach is February, with average low temperatures of 6°C. The average temperature during this period is around 7°C.
What is the wettest time of year in Long Beach?
The wettest month in Long Beach is January, with an average of 262mm of precipitation.
What is the driest time of year in Long Beach?
The driest month in Long Beach is August, with an average of 16mm of precipitation.
